Kings Norton Golf Club was founded in 1892 when David Brown, then professional at The Worcestershire, Malvern was paid the princely sum of 15 shillings to lay out a nine-hole course approximately one mile from Kings Norton Railway Station.
Set in 300 acres of beautiful parkland lies this majestic complex. The Club has hosted various PGA Tour events and is universally accepted as one of the finest courses in the Midlands. The Club is just 7 miles from the centre of Birmingham, 1 mile from junction 3 of the M42 and within easy reach of the National Exhibition Centre and Birmingham Airport.
